Understanding the Legal Landscape of Cultivated Cannabinoids
The legal landscape of cultivated cannabinoids is complex and rapidly evolving, with a stark divide between federal and state regulations in markets like the United States. Federally, cannabinoids derived from cannabis remain Schedule I controlled substances, creating significant hurdles for banking, research, and interstate commerce. However, state-legal hemp programs provide a pathway for products containing delta-9 THC below 0.3% dry weight, while novel synthetics like delta-8 exist in a contentious gray area. Navigating this requires meticulous attention to the specific compound’s source, jurisdictional laws, and evolving Food and Drug Administration guidance to ensure full compliance and mitigate substantial legal risk.

Cultivation Techniques for Premium Quality
Cultivation techniques for premium quality demand meticulous attention from soil to harvest. It begins with selecting superior genetics and nurturing them in optimized, living soil rich in organic matter. Strategic canopy management and precise irrigation are non-negotiable for plant health. The most critical phase is the harvest window; patience is paramount for peak cannabinoid and terpene expression. Proper drying and curing then lock in this potential, transforming good flower into exceptional, connoisseur-grade product. This rigorous process is the definitive foundation for achieving superior potency and flavor, ensuring a product that commands respect and fulfills the highest market expectations.

Achieving **premium quality cultivation** starts with perfecting the basics. It’s all about attentive, hands-on care rather than shortcuts. Key techniques include precise canopy management to optimize light exposure, strict water stress protocols to intensify flavors, and meticulous harvest timing—often by hand at the coolest part of the day. The real secret is in the soil; living soils teeming with beneficial microbes create a complex root ecosystem, which directly translates to superior aroma, potency, and taste in the final product.
**Q: Is organic always better for premium quality?**
A: Not necessarily. While organic practices often build excellent soil, some top-tier cultivators use precisely calibrated mineral nutrients with equal success. The consistency and control of the grower matter more than the label.
